Vinyl banner locations
Have you given thought as to how the location of a vinyl banner ties in with advertising? The key is maximum visibility. At tradeshows for example, banners can be prominently displayed at the back of the booth and across the front of the table at an exhibit. You might even be able to place the banner by the entrance or somewhere inside or outside the venue though this might incur additional costs and fees, but it might be worth it if you gain additional exposure.
What information can a vinyl banner show?
In today’s digital age, a banner must include a company’s website and social media links and if relevant, include a QR code for immediate purchases. The text on the banner should be appealing and easy-to-read. The bigger the locale, the more prominent the text should be. Slogans on vinyl banners stretching across billboards are a good example of effective advertising.
Remember that at a big venue in a high traffic area, your banner needs to get the information across about your product or service in the fastest way possible for the advertising to be cost-effective. For starters, put yourself in the shoes of one of the prospects at the tradeshow or convention. Is your vinyl banner appealing enough for your prospect to check out your product or service? Remember, at these big indoor events such as tradeshows and conventions for example, there will be other banners that will be directly competing with yours. If your prospects have never heard of your business, then you’ve got just that one chance before they run off to pay attention to something else.
Vinyl Banner Applications
Vinyl Banners are best suited for outdoor use but can also be used indoors. The most often used applications for vinyl banners are:
- Company logo promotion
- Special promotions
- Events
- Teams
- Schools
- Church Functions
Vinyl banners can be seen anywhere due to its very flexible and portable material. Most commonly seen as:
- Billboards
- Table banners
- Trade show banners
- Building banners
- Street banners
- Festival banners
- Stadium flags
